[split] Having already cut old cassette tapes from the Levant, DJ K-Sets' Manuel Sánchez has now ventured back to Los Angeles' Iranian community of the 1980s and 1990s. All pop tracks on the 22-minute long mix were recorded and produced stateside by Persian labels, featuring the likes Gloria Rohani, Afsaneh and Pouya.
